Announced at PASSPO x predia x palet's end of year show tonight.. From 2013, PASSPO will start using the name “PASSPO☆” instead of ぱすぽ☆!

PASSPO will also go on a nation-wide tour next year in Japan!



They also announced they will release their 7th major single on February 13 2013. It's a sakura-themed sad love song and the musical theme is digi-rock. The title of the single is 'Sakura Komachi'. ^ Sorry for the late reply. The rules are enforced and it made a big difference. The first concert I went to in July 2011 at Shibuya AX was one of the last concerts they did without any rules (they did two more concerts at Shinjuku Blaze a couple weeks later and then announced the new rules at their staff blog). Incidentally the concert I went to was also Natsumi's birthday concert.  When I went back a couple months later in November the rules were in full affect - no more moshing, girls had there own area, and there was a "jumping" area in the back. Totally different experience. PASSPO has a lot of girl fans and the Shibuya AX concert was totally out of control and I imagine a lot of them got injured or just really annoyed at that concert, so I think that is why the changes happened. I think a girl's area would have fixed the problem, but then they also banned moshing on top of that. I didn't go to one of their concerts in 2012 though, so maybe things have changed a litte since. ^^ The fan club complicates things a little. The FC actually used to be a bigger deal when they first started, and over the years they've gradually reduced the amount of FC concerts  and perks. Like they no longer do "frequent flyer mileage" (fans used to scan a QR code at the entrance to the concert and get points for the concerts they go to). There's only a few FC-only concerts a year though. Another thing is sometimes tickets go on sale a few weeks in advance for FC members (a lot of groups do this for their FC members, but it's more of an issue for overseas PASSPO fans because these tickets don't go on resale as much, so if you are buying a normal ticket it's going to be a higher number).
